Enigma Code
- Who is the girl? Who is the boy?
- Where are they heading? What has happened previously? (they are drunk, so we presume some sort of beach party)
- The girl runs into the water, and the serenity suggests that something big will happen next - tension and enigma is created whilst she swims along the horizon calmly
- High angle, under water shot accompanied by tense music - something is about to happen
- What has got the girl?
Action Code
- The girl and boy run along the beach, heading to somewhere which is not yet known to the viewer
- The woman takes her top off - we expect that she will go skinny dipping
- The man keeps stumbling as he tries to chase the woman - we presume that he will not catch her
- The man tries to undress himself, gives up, and lies down on the sand - he will not be able to save the girl
- Something in the water has got the girl - it is chasing her, not letting her go - what is it? This creates even more suspense - will the girl survive?
Semiotic Code
- The beach setting - usually symbolises holidays, fun, relaxation
- Beautiful sunset - happiness, calm, serenity
- Girl is wearing gold hooped hearings; privileged, glamorous, girly
- The buoy - usually symbolises safety
- Dark lighting - creates a foreboding atmosphere - suggests that something is going to happen
Cultural Code
- The idea of skinny dipping - fun thing to do, usually by young people
- They are drunk
- The beach setting; beautiful coast and sunset, typically a place of relaxation
- Shark attack
- The girl screams; typical sound effect in a horror movie
- Silence at the end - when a big, scary even occurs, it is usually followed by silence
Symbolic Code
- Themes of eagerness (at the start)
- As the girl flails around in the sea, she is desperate for help - she is alone and helpless
- A sense of foreboding (the grey clouds)
- Danger (built up by tense music)
